如何将plist填充到UITableView - ios中

时间:2012-03-20 08:45:02

标签: ios uitableview plist

首先,我知道这个头衔有可能让我失宠,但请在做出判断之前重新提出这个问题: - )

我有一个包含数据的Plist,我现在已经填写了 - 因为将来我希望应用能够填充这个,但这是下一步。

我已经找了很长时间的答案如何做到这一点,并认为条款(或沿着线路)IOS TUTORIAL - 如何使用plist填充UITableView - 可以做到这一点,但没有任何帮助已经出现了。

有没有人在这里得到我可以遵循的教程,我不是在这里试图在没有研究的情况下找到答案,我只是有点卡住: - )

我有Xcode 4.3.1并且我正在为至少5.0 iOS设备设计应用程序 - 这样我就可以将代码保留在该频谱中。

任何帮助都很棒: - )

杰夫

1 个答案:

答案 0 :(得分:2)

如何使用类方法?:

+(NSArray *)plistToArray {
    NSBundle *bundle = [NSBundle mainBundle];
    NSString *path = [bundle pathForResource:@"MyPListFile" ofType:@"plist"];
    NSDictionary *dict= [[NSDictionary alloc] initWithContentsOfFile:path];


    NSArray *retArr = [NSArray arrayWithArray:[dictobjectForKey:@"MyPListRootEntry"]];
    return retArr;
}